If you end up with a hole on the bottom front of the receiver because of installing a different lower hand guard that does not need the screw, you can use the next size larger to fill that hole. Not all of these plugs are made the same way. The Hillman are a harder plastic and snap into the holes (if properly sized) firmly for a really nice fit. I have attempted to use the vinyl type - they easily distort and don't look as nice.

I did this also, just to the side holes. Has anyone done the two holes forward of the trigger on the bottom of the receiver?

 

Another awesome hardware store fix is to get some small cotter keys to retain axis pins. This way you can individually remove pins and have the other positively retained.
